Concrete Waterproofing in Tampa, FL
Concrete waterproofing services help protect foundations, basements, driveways, and other concrete structures from water intrusion and damage. This process involves applying specialized sealants or membranes to prevent moisture from seeping through concrete surfaces, which can lead to cracks, mold growth, and structural deterioration over time. Homeowners often request waterproofing for projects such as basement sealing, retaining wall protection, or ensuring outdoor concrete surfaces like patios and walkways remain dry and durable. Before requesting this service, property owners typically want to understand the types of waterproofing materials used, the areas that need treatment, and how the process can help prevent future water-related issues.
It is important for property owners to consider the specific conditions of their concrete surfaces, such as exposure to water, soil type, and existing damage, when planning waterproofing projects. Clarifying the scope of work and understanding any necessary preparatory steps can help ensure the effectiveness of the treatment. Waterproofing is a valuable step in maintaining the integrity of concrete structures, especially in areas prone to heavy rain or high humidity, like Tampa and surrounding regions. Properly executed waterproofing can extend the lifespan of concrete and reduce maintenance needs over time.

Common Concrete Waterproofing Jobs
Basement and foundation wa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ects structural integrity.
Driveway and garage sealing - shields concrete surfaces from moisture damage and staining.
Patio and walkway waterproofing - helps maintain surface durability and appearance over time.
Retaining wall waterproofing - reduces the risk of cracks and erosion caused by water pressure.
Crawl space sealing - minimizes moisture buildup that can lead to mold and wood rot.
Pool deck waterproofing - preserves concrete surfaces and prevents water-related deterioration.
Concrete Waterproofing Questions
What is concrete waterproofing? It involves applying protective barriers or sealants to prevent water from penetrating concrete surfaces, reducing damage and deterioration.
Which projects benefit from waterproofing? Foundations, basements, driveways, and retaining walls commonly require waterproofing to prevent water intrusion and related issues.
How does waterproofing protect a property? It helps prevent water leaks, mold growth, and structural damage caused by moisture infiltration over time.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Common methods include membrane coatings, sealants, and drainage systems designed to keep water away from concrete surfaces.
